Description



Tenure: Freehold

This house has been lovingly owned by the same family for the last 24 years and offers spacious and flexible accommodation.

It is set in an idyllic semi-rural village on a quiet road, with a beautiful landscaped garden to the rear.


A driveway offers off road parking for 3 vehicles with access to an attached garage. The remaining frontage is given over to lawn.

The bright entrance hall has a useful cloakroom and opens into a versatile layout that is ideal for family life.

You have a large lounge with views onto the garden. There is a lovely kitchen/diner with a larder and, in addition, a study which could also be used as a playroom or 4th bedroom.

On the first floor there is a bright landing and 3 good sized bedrooms plus a family bathroom.

As you would expect the property comes with gas central heating and double glazing. 

Externally there is a large and sunny mature rear garden which has been enjoyed by the vendors during their tenure. There is also an outside power point.

In our opinion the property offers great scope for extension to both the rear and side and is just waiting for a new owner to make it into a forever home.

What made you choose the property when you bought it?
Firstly, we liked the position of the house. Langton Green has always been a desirable place to live and we liked the lane on which the house was situated.
We loved the garden, which we felt had character, was low maintenance and was not overlooked.
Inside, we loved the aspect of the lounge with the patio doors giving a view of the garden. We felt that the house would be perfect for raising our family.

What have you enjoyed about living there?
We have found the house perfect for family life, particularly the large lounge and, in addition, the study has proved invaluable for my work. The garden is wonderful and we spend a lot of time outside in the summer. The garage and long driveway, which provides space for three cars, have proved very useful. Farnham Lane has a definite village feel to it, yet it is close to Tunbridge Wells. The primary school (outstanding), is a short walk away and there are outstanding grammar schools in Tunbridge Wells, a short bus ride away.
One aspect that we have particularly enjoyed are the walks available from our doorstep. There are lovely country walks in every direction, including walks to some fantastic country pubs!
It is a short walk to the village shops and cafe and a 10-15 minute walk to Rusthall, with its larger selection of shops and medical practice.
